2017-09-28 3 views
0

Wie kann ich Text FILE NAME, PAGE NAME, PAGE OF PAGES in einen automatischen Code ändern, Wenn ich &F für den Dateinamen verwende, bekomme ich Routing und alles vermasselt.Excel-Dateiname, Blattname und Seiten

Es ist in Excel:

Sub Podnozje() 
' 
' Podnozje Makro 
' 
    Application.PrintCommunication = False 
    With ActiveSheet.PageSetup 
     .PrintTitleRows = "" 
     .PrintTitleColumns = "" 
    End With 
    Application.PrintCommunication = True 
    ActiveSheet.PageSetup.PrintArea = "" 
    Application.PrintCommunication = False 
    With ActiveSheet.PageSetup 
     .LeftHeader = "" 
     .CenterHeader = "" 
     .RightHeader = "" 
     .LeftFooter = "&""Arial,Standard""&10Ersteller: CUTC HR" 
     .CenterFooter = "&""Arial,Standard""&10FILE NAME" & Chr(10) & "PAGE NAME" & Chr(10) & "PAGE OF PAGES" 
     .RightFooter = "&""Arial,Standard""&10Druckdatum: &Date" 
    End With 
    Application.PrintCommunication = True 
End Sub 

Antwort

0

In einer frischen Arbeitsmappe den folgenden Code

Option Explicit 

Public Sub GenerateFooters() 
    With ActiveSheet.PageSetup 
     .LeftFooter = "" 
     .CenterFooter = "" 
     .RightFooter = "" 'sometimes I had issues without clearing the footer first 

     .LeftFooter = "&""Arial,Standard""&10 Ersteller: CUTC HR" 
     .CenterFooter = "&""Arial,Standard""&10 &F" & Chr(10) & "&A" & Chr(10) & "Seite &P von &N" 
     .RightFooter = "&""Arial,Standard""&10 Druckdatum: &D" 
    End With 
End Sub 

Ergebnisse in

enter image description here


Diese ar e die gültigen Codes:

  • &P - die aktuelle Seitennummer.
  • &N - die Gesamtzahl der Seiten.
  • &B - verwenden Sie eine Fettschrift *.
  • &I - verwenden Sie eine kursive Schriftart *.
  • &U - Verwenden Sie eine Unterstreichungsschrift *.
  • && - das Zeichen '&'.
  • &D - das aktuelle Datum.
  • &T - die aktuelle Zeit.
  • &F - Arbeitsmappename.
  • &A - Arbeitsblattname.
  • &"FontName" - Verwenden Sie den angegebenen Schriftnamen.
  • &N - verwenden Sie die angegebene Schriftgröße.
+0

Danke. Es funktioniert – skrimina

Verwandte Themen